CRA My Account is arguably the most important free tool available to Canadian taxpayers, yet millions of Canadians still haven’t set it up. In under 15 minutes, you get instant access to your RRSP and TFSA contribution room, past Notices of Assessment, refund tracking, and the Auto-fill feature that imports your T4 and T5 slips directly into tax software. Auto-fill My Return

What It Is

FeatureDetails
Tax slip importCRA sends to software
Slips availableT4, T5, T3, etc.
Time saverNo manual entry

How to Use

StepAction
1Use certified tax software
2Connect to CRA account
3Authorize software
4Slips auto-import
5Verify accuracy

Auto-fill is the single biggest time-saver in CRA My Account. Instead of manually entering every T4, T5, T4A, and RRSP receipt, your tax software pulls the data directly from CRA’s records. This dramatically reduces data entry errors — one of the most common tax mistakes — and ensures you don’t miss slips from banks or employers you’ve forgotten about. Just note that not all slips are available on the first day of tax season; waiting until mid-March gives CRA time to collect all third-party data.

The Bottom Line

Setting up CRA My Account takes about 15 minutes and pays dividends every tax season. Use the Sign-In Partner option (your bank login) for the fastest registration, set up direct deposit immediately for faster refunds, and take advantage of Auto-fill when filing through certified tax software. Check your RRSP and TFSA room at least once a year to avoid penalties.
